> The problem is the following.
>
> I have an api wich connects to the differents WS and gave me all the
> DAOs. But when i try to use the API in the server side, in a
> ServiceImpl class i get the followoing error:
>
> javax.xml.ws.Service is a restricted class. Please see the Google  App
> Engine developer's guide for more details.
>
> This problem i think is because this class is not in the Appengine
> Whitelist (http://code.google.com/appengine/docs/java/
> jrewhitelist.html<http://code.google.com/appengine/docs/java/%0Ajrewhitelist.html>)
> but it dosnt have to be a problem if i want to
> deploy the application in a Tomcat Server for example.
>
> Buuuuuuut because of the above error, my problem is that i can't make
> the GWT compiler to get run and compile the js files.
>
> How could i do?
